Polaris Renewable Energy Inc. (TSE:PIF - Get Free Report) shares reached a new 52-week high during tr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as high as C$13.94 and last traded at C$13.93, with a volume of 28512 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$13.73.

About Polaris Renewable Energy

Polaris Infrastructure Inc is engaged in the acquisition, exploration, development and operation of geothermal and hydroelectric energy projects. The company, through its subsidiaries, owns and operates a 72-megawatt capacity geothermal facility (the San Jacinto Project), located in northwest Nicaragua.
